Quick Tips and Facts
- Key West has a low-key, beachy vibe, making it easy to pack essentials like flip-flops, swimsuits, sunscreen, and sunglasses.
- The best time to visit Key West with your family is during the winter months when the weather is mild and pleasant.
- Key West is known for its stunning sunsets, so make sure to catch one during your visit!
- The island is relatively small, making it easy to get around on foot, by bike, or by renting a golf cart.
- Don’t forget to try some of the delicious local cuisine, including fresh seafood and Key lime pie!
Background: Key West – A Family-Friendly Paradise

Key West, the southernmost point of the continental United States, is a small island located in the Florida Keys. It’s known for its vibrant culture, stunning natural beauty, and rich history. Key West has long been a popular destination for tourists, but it’s also a fantastic place for families to explore and enjoy.
The island offers a wide range of family-friendly activities, from educational excursions to outdoor adventures. Whether you’re interested in learning about marine life at the Key West Aquarium, exploring the fascinating exhibits at the Florida Keys Eco-Discovery Center, or embarking on a thrilling snorkeling trip, Key West has it all. And let’s not forget about the beautiful beaches, where you can relax, swim, and build sandcastles to your heart’s content.

Day 2: Exploring the Town and Educational Excursions
On day two, it’s time to explore the charming town of Key West and take part in some educational excursions. Start your day by visiting the Key West Aquarium, where you and your family can get up close and personal with a variety of marine life. From sharks to sea turtles, the aquarium offers a fascinating glimpse into the underwater world.

After the aquarium, head over to the Florida Keys Eco-Discovery Center, where you can learn about the unique ecosystems of the Florida Keys. The center features interactive exhibits and educational displays that are sure to captivate both kids and adults.

For lunch, make your way to the Conch Republic Seafood Company, a family-friendly restaurant that serves up delicious seafood dishes. Afterward, head to the Mel Fisher Maritime Museum, where you can learn about the fascinating history of shipwrecks and treasure hunting in the Florida Keys.

Is Duval Street OK for kids?
Yes, Duval Street is perfectly OK for kids during the day. While it’s known for its bars and nightlife, during the daytime, Duval Street offers a vibrant atmosphere with shops, restaurants, and street performers. It’s a great place to take a leisurely stroll and soak in the unique culture and charm of Key West.
